The standard error (sigma) for DALE is equal to the square root of the sum of the product of each state's weight squared by the state's variance. This can be further described by the square root of (1.0 squared times the variance of LE state 1 plus 0.8 squared times the variance of LE state 2 plus 0.65 squared times the variance of LE state 3 plus 0.5 squared times the variance of LE state 4).
